如何配置iis使其支持php,iiS PHP,让iiS支持php语言,iiS下配置php运行环境教程图解

如何配置iis使其支持php,iiS PHP,让iiS支持php语言,iiS下配置php运行环境教程图解iiSPHP 让 iiS 支持 php 语言 iiS 下配置 php 运行环境教程图解 IIs 是 windows 系统下的互联网信息服务 大家主要用于搭建 wEB 服务器 IIs 中已经自带了 AsP 语言的支持 不过现在许多网页系统都是 php 编写的 并且 php 具有更高的运行效率 想让 IIs 支持 php 的话还需要配置 php 运行环境 下面小编就具体分享下 IIs 怎么安装 php 支持 IIs 配置 PHP 三步骤 1 下载 PHP 的文件包

iiS PHP,让iiS支持php语言,iiS下配置php运行环境教程图解?

IIs是windows系统下的互联网信息服务,大家主要用于搭建wEB服务器,IIs中已经自带了AsP语言的支持,不过现在许多网页系统都是php编写的,并且php具有更高的运行效率,想让IIs支持php的话还需要配置php运行环境,下面小编就具体分享下IIs怎么安装php支持。

IIs配置PHP三步骤:

1.下载PHP的文件包;

2.配置PHP;

3.将PHP扩展引入IIs;

4.测试php环境

第一步:下载PHP组件

下载地址:http://windows.php.net/download  PHP的windows版本提供的是一个压缩包文件,包含了所有需要的文件,安装非常简单,傻瓜式的。

版本择三点注意事项:

1.选中PHP版本,主要分为PHP5.X和PHP7.X两种,按照需要选中便可,如果是初入门,其实可以直接从PHP7入手,这个版本引入了一系列Coooooool的特性以及极大的运行效率提高;如果是有指定的框架或者项目需求的话,参照文档选中版本便可。

2.选中解决器架构,主要指X86和X64,分别是32位和64位的,成文时已经是2017年,相信大部分开发者的解决器和系统都是X64架构的,直接选中这个版本吧。

3.选中线程安全版本,这个依据需要选中便可。Threadsafe相对而言因为需要兼顾线程安全,所以相对来说会有一些效率损失,但是损失不大;如果是使用FastCGI的话可以直接选中Non-Threadsafe。

总而言之,如果你无特殊需求的话,我建议你选中PHP7.X X64 Non-Threadsafe(PHP7,64位架构,非线程安全版本)。

第二步:配置PHP

首先选中一个目录解压,建议在你编程所使用的硬盘根目录下建立文件夹,把文件都解压在其中。这是由于今后的PHP请求都会向这个指定位置中的CGI程序请求,最好不要经常有变动。

a8132d48ecdb9cd19075282b6bae0bdc.png

然后将这个目录(本文中是”E:\PHP”)添加到Path常量中(右键“我的电脑”=>属性=>高级系统设置=>高级选项卡右下角环境变量=>系统变量=>Path),注意一定要在添加前加入”;”分号用于分割。添加到Path变量后,使用PHP文件夹中的内容可以不用写入完整路径,直接键入文件名便可(具体可以搜索一下windows命令行的检索顺序)。

然后将其中的“php.ini-development”文件复制一份,将副本重命名为“php.ini”,这里面是PHP官网建议的开发用PHP配置,对于初学者,大家不需要做一点修改;如果你的目标框架或者项目有要求,按照要求进行更改(比如要求指定扩展等)。

至此,PHP配置完成。

第三步:引入IIs

首先点击IIs管理工具,选中“解决应用程序映射”。

2e89d340212a68fc091b65236ff33091.png

在新的界面选中“添加模块映射”

c876274bc2748e551a7f47fcd486c32f.png

填写信息如下:

706c104a85cae6f6aa9302d787253b94.png

其中第一行是代表哪些文件会交给PHP解决,填写*.php的意思是所有以PHP为扩展名的文件都会交给php-cgi来解决。

第二行代表这个模块映射的类型,如果无特殊需求大家选中FastCGI。

第三行代表解决模块的位置,进入大家PHP的解压目录下,选中php-cgi.exe便可。

名称只是用来标志,可以随意填写。

打开确定以后会询问你是不自动添加允许规则,确认便可。

至此IIs安装PHP扩展结束。

第四步:测试

在默认网站目录下新建一个test.php文件,在其中填写

phpinfo();

?>

然后点击浏览器访问localhost\test.php,显示如下信息说明安装成功。

a0b0fcb7e7eb36e6e86ba742876a4817.png

如何样,在IIs下安装php运行环境也不是那么困难吧,随着网络服务已经成为主要的服务,服务器的搭建也越来越简单,现在网上还有许多php+服务器一体的管理工具,一键便可安装好所有需要的运行环境,我们也可以找找。

版权声明:本文内容由互联网用户自发贡献,该文观点仅代表作者本人。本站仅提供信息存储空间服务,不拥有所有权,不承担相关法律责任。如发现本站有涉嫌侵权/违法违规的内容, 请联系我们举报,一经查实,本站将立刻删除。

发布者:全栈程序员-站长,转载请注明出处:https://javaforall.net/202676.html原文链接:https://javaforall.net

(0)
上一篇 2026年3月19日 下午11:34
下一篇 2026年3月19日 下午11:34


相关推荐

发表回复

您的邮箱地址不会被公开。 必填项已用 * 标注

关注全栈程序员社区公众号